Benue APC Chairman Omale Appreciates Party Faithful, Tasks Youths and Women on Gov. Alia’s Re-election

From Dooshima Terkura, Makurdi

The Chairman of the ruling All Progressives Congress (APC) in Benue State, Chief Benjamin Omale, has called for unity among party faithful, urging them to sustain their support for the party to ensure the re-election of Governor Hyacinth Alia in 2027.


Chief Omale made the call while hosting party faithful, including youths and women, to a dinner at his Makurdi residence, organised to thank God for His protection, guidance and faithfulness to the APC family in Benue State throughout 2025.

The event brought together critical stakeholders, including members of the media, security chiefs, women groups and the Alia Performing Musicians (APM) from across the state.
According to the APC chairman, the unity, strength and renewed commitment of the party, especially as the political atmosphere gradually shifts towards the 2027 general elections, are crucial to achieving victory at the polls.
Omale explained that the gathering was also organised to appreciate party members, particularly youths and women, for their loyalty, sacrifices and unwavering support for the party at all levels.
He commended the APC youths for what he described as their “homefront soldier-like” commitment in confronting dangers and risks while remaining unharmed, stressing that unity and peace remain powerful tools for building a successful political party and winning elections, especially as the party works towards the re-election of Governor Alia.
“The party wants to appreciate the youths in a special way for supporting His Excellency and ensuring that the Alia movement is not cut short. You have truly made us proud in the state,” Omale said. “You have promoted the party beyond reasonable doubt, and that is why I chose to host you and a few others to this dinner.
“So, thank you for your sacrifice, love, patience and moral support, as well as for promoting the good works of His Excellency, Governor Alia. I want to assure you that this new year holds a lot of hope, promise and aspirations that will lead you to your next destination.”
He further assured that Governor Alia has the interest of the youths at heart, adding that they would be adequately incorporated into the administration’s plans from 2026 onward.
“I want to assure you that Governor Alia thinks about you, plans with you and will incorporate you into his plans come 2026. I will ensure that the youths of Benue State are not disenfranchised but remain firm wherever they are. The party will support you in all your activities to keep the people united and promote the party, especially towards the re-election of Governor Hyacinth Alia in 2027,” he said.
Omale added that the party is proud of the youths because of their understanding of the terrain and pledged continued support for their efforts.
The APC chairman, who is also the Chairman of the Enugu Orthopaedic Hospital, used the occasion to acknowledge the contributions of the Alia Performing Musicians (APM) for using music to promote the achievements and good governance of Governor Alia in the state.
He announced that the party would soon launch a platform to be known as “Alia Praise Singers,” which would bring together musicians to accompany the governor and celebrate his achievements in line with his performance.
“To the Alia Performing Musicians, we have not abandoned you. We allowed you to grow stronger, and now that we have seen your standard, we are confident you are ready to be presented to His Excellency,” he said.
Omale also thanked the media, security agencies and other critical stakeholders for their understanding, cooperation and support in ensuring the success of the Alia administration, assuring them of continued partnership.
Earlier, the Senior Special Assistant to the Governor on Youth Mobilisation and Illegal Levies, Mr Terver Gbenda, praised Chief Omale for his leadership style, openness and commitment to the growth of the APC in Benue State.
He described the get-together as timely and necessary for strengthening bonds among party members across the state and pledged to continue mobilising youths to support Governor Alia’s administration and work towards his victory in 2027.
